Tours of the costume shop will include historical accounts of the c. 1809 Jones House, which, among other things, was used as a prison during the Civil War, and a brief tour of the home’s exterior.

Inside the Jones House, the tour will visit the costume racks on the first floor, where all manner of period dresses and clothes hang. The costumer will discuss the research techniques used to ensure the costumes are produced using historically accurate techniques and fabrics. Also observe the costume team at work tailoring, mending, and creating costumes to be featured in events at Tryon Palace throughout the year.
